标题:计算单词数、行数、字符数!求解
取消只看楼主
卡其
Rank: 2
等 级:论坛游民
帖 子:96
专家分:36
注 册:2010-8-30
结帖率:100%
已结贴  问题点数:20 回复次数:1 
计算单词数、行数、字符数!求解
程序代码:
#include<stdio.h>
#define  IN  1      /*inside a word*/
#define  OUT  0     /*outside a word*/
main()
{
      int c,word_amount,word_row,character,state;
      state=OUT;
      word_amount=word_row=character=0;
    while((c=getchar())!=EOF)
      {
          ++character;
          if(c='\n')
             ++word_row;
        if(c=='\n'||c=='\t'||c==' ')
               state=OUT;
        else if(state=OUT)
               state=IN;
               ++word_amount;
      }
      printf("%d,%d,%d",word_amount,word_row,character);
      }
      getchar();
      getchar();
}



那里出现问题了。输出的结果有问题
搜索更多相关主题的帖子: word character outside color 
2012-07-04 22:54
卡其
Rank: 2
等 级:论坛游民
帖 子:96
专家分:36
注 册:2010-8-30
得分:0 
回复 2楼 随风飘荡
改好了、谢谢咯
2012-07-05 12:39



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-372767-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.248280 second(s), 8 queries.
Copyright©2004-2025, BCCN.NET, All Rights Reserved